How they compare
Namibia currently reports 54.5 against 54.2 in El Salvador, a difference of 0.3.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 17 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Namibia ahead.
El Salvador ranks 52nd and Namibia ranks 50th of 186 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, El Salvador averaged higher in 2 and Namibia in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| El Salvador | Namibia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 52.47 | 50.1 | 2.37 | El Salvador |
| 2010s | 51.82 | 50.9 | 0.92 | El Salvador |
| 2020s | 54.2 | 54.5 | 0.3 | Namibia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
